The invention relates to the technical field of robots, and provides a multifunctional combined type mobile robot which comprises a robot body (1). The driving walking wheels (2) are arranged on transmission shafts at four corners of two sides of the machine body (1); the stress deformation wheels (3) and the driving walking wheels (2) are coaxially arranged, and the stress deformation wheels (3) shrink and deform when subjected to external force; the crawler belt (4) is arranged on the driving walking wheel (2) and the stress deformation wheel (3); the obstacle crossing structure (5) is supported on the side, away from the driving walking wheel (2), of the stress deformation wheel (3) and located on the outer side of the crawler belt (4); when the crawler belt part located at the stress deformation wheel (3) and the stress deformation wheel (3) are extruded by an obstacle, the crawler belt part contracts along with the stress deformation wheel (3), and at the moment, the obstacle crossing structure (5) supports and rolls to climb over the obstacle. The advantages of different motion modes can be played, and the moving efficiency, universality and operation efficiency of the robot are effectively improved.
